Your Impact

  • Be a key player on a collaborative team, working with Primary Care Providers, Medical Assistants, and Behavioral Health professionals.
  • Offer guidance to patients by responding to health inquiries over the phone, drawing on your knowledge of illness and injury to carefully assess and advise without in-person contact.
  • Engage in inbox management using our Electronic Medical Record (EMR) system, ensuring efficient communication and follow-up with patients.
  • Provide vital case management and care coordination, including triaging patients, overseeing immunization administration, and ensuring smooth transitions from hospital care to nurse visits.
  • Educate patients on health management, medication use, and wellness strategies, fostering understanding and promoting proactive care.
  • Monitor controlled medication refills and collaborate closely with providers to review test results and ensure timely patient follow-up.
  • Use nationally recognized triage protocols to assess patient needs, developing care plans based on phone conversations and medical record reviews.
